Hello again and welcome back. The topic for this week is graphics, and the focus will be on the creating your own cartoon characters. My software tool of choice for making 'toons is Anim8or, which aside from being a free program, has all the features you need to make your own characters. A good way to start is by building a figure out of primitives and simple shapes.
The samples below were created using Anim8or.
